Announcement

Free to view yesterday and today
Customer Service: cat_manager

Firedancer - High-Performance Solana Validator Client

Firedancer is an open-source validator client for the Solana blockchain, developed by Jump Crypto. Engineered for performance and robustness, it aims to diversify the Solana validator ecosystem and provide a high-throughput alternative to the existing client.

C
Added on 2025年6月7日
View on GitHub
Firedancer - High-Performance Solana Validator Client preview
1,181
Stars
260
Forks
C
Language

Project Introduction

Summary

Firedancer is a new, high-performance open-source validator client for the Solana blockchain. Developed by Jump Crypto, it offers a critical alternative implementation to bolster network decentralization and performance.

Problem Solved

The Solana network currently relies heavily on a single validator client implementation. Firedancer addresses this risk by providing a high-performance, independent client, increasing the diversity and resilience of the network.

Core Features

Alternative Client Implementation

Provides a completely independent implementation of the Solana validator logic, enhancing network resilience.

High Performance Architecture

Designed with a focus on raw performance and throughput to maximize transaction processing capacity.

Improved Security and Stability

Aims for enhanced security and stability through a fresh codebase and rigorous testing.

Tech Stack

C
C++
Solana Blockchain
Networking
High-Performance Computing

Use Cases

Firedancer's primary use case is operating a validator node on the Solana network. Specific scenarios include:

Operating a Production Validator

Details

Running a high-throughput validator node to participate in transaction processing and consensus on the Solana mainnet or devnet.

User Value

Contributes to the health and decentralization of the Solana network while potentially achieving higher transaction throughput.

Testing and Benchmarking

Details

Using Firedancer in a testing or development environment to experiment with Solana validator operations or benchmark performance against the existing client.

User Value

Gain insights into performance characteristics and validate compatibility within diverse infrastructure setups.

Recommended Projects

You might be interested in these projects

jdxmise

mise (formerly rtxd) is a blazing fast polyglot version manager and task runner for developers, simplifying tool installation, environment variable management, and project-specific task execution across multiple languages and projects.

Rust
16049531
View Details

coolsnowwolflede

An optimized and feature-rich custom build source for OpenWrt/LEDE, providing advanced networking capabilities and stability for compatible router hardware.

C
3068119573
View Details

sharkdpbat

Bat is a modern alternative to the classic 'cat' command, offering syntax highlighting, Git integration, automatic paging, and other enhancements for viewing text files in the terminal.

Rust
528311298
View Details